Traffic Accident Claim-What You Should Know

Friday, October 22nd, 2010

When out driving you not only have to worry about road conditions but the other drivers on the road as well. You can be the most careful driver out there but it only takes one careless person to cause an accident.

Are you confident in your ability to file a traffic accident claim if you happen to find yourself in that situation? Have you reviewed your policy lately and made sure that you have enough? Are you covered by non owners insurance if you are in a collision in a vehicle that you don’t own?

If an accident you are involved in happens to have injuries then you need to be sure your insurance policy will cover that. Be sure before you find yourself filing a traffic accident claim that you have sufficient insurance to cover any situation.

If you don’t have enough insurance coverage to take care of you, your passengers, and others at the scene then you need to reevaluate your policy. If your policy doesn’t cover all of the damages or injuries then those injured could come after you personally for compensation. This might not only be the driver of the other vehicle but your own passengers or pedestrians involved as well.

When you put yourself behind the wheel of a vehicle, whether it be your own or a friends, you need to make sure that you are covered in any situation. This will protect you in the long run.

It is wise to keep your insurance policy and other papers organized and in a place that you and any other person covered in your policy can find it. Also carry proof with you in your wallet because this will help you out if you are driving a borrowed car belonging to someone else.

Some information that you want to be sure to take note of if you happen to find yourself in a wreck is the name and address of all person involved and at the scene of the accident. You can use witnesses if you have to go to court to get compensation for the accident. If you are able to call people in that were at the scene to speak on your behalf then you can strengthen your traffic accident claim.

Be sure to always wait for the police to arrive at the traffic accident even if there is no noticeable damage to either vehicle. You can run into a lot of problems if there is no police report filed at the scene and may not be compensated for any damages or injuries.

A police report is one of the strongest pieces of evidence that can help you win your case if it does go to court. Don’t believe anyone that tells you they will take care of your damages or injuries and asks you not to call the police. They may decide to take you to court and make your prove your case. This will be hard to do without a police report.

Review your policy today and make sure you have enough coverage. Don’t wait until you are filing a traffic accident claim to pull your policy out and read through it.

Automobile Condition Vs. Cost

Thursday, October 14th, 2010

Many car dealerships in Houston push the price of a car as the selling point of a particular car. They strategically put stickers of the Manufacture Suggested Retail Price (MSRP) on the car so it can appear to be estimated more than what they will sell it for. Right off the bat the price of the car can be decreased by a few hundred dollars because it’s just a suggested price that the manufacturer tells the dealership in order for them to make a substantial amount of profit.

Many car dealerships in Houston will then use the “cushion” they have on the cost to make you think you are privileged when they drop it by a few thousand dollars.

The best way to shop for a car is to breakdown the value of what it’s worth over it’s lifespan. This is done easily by calculating the price you pay for the car now, then adding all of the maintenance fees you’ll pay over the next few years. For example, let’s say you buy a 2002 Honda Civic ES with 80,000 miles for $6,500.

It’s important that you assess the price of repairs. You can get this estimate based on the overall health of the car. Categories that measure a vehicle’s health are: engine components (such as the motor, radiator, alternator, air filter, battery, etc); tires, exterior components like windshield wipers, headlights, taillights, suspension, brakes. It’s also always good to get a second opinion and use resources like www.AutoCheck.com and www.CarFax.com to check a vehicle history report.

If the car is in “okay” condition, then it’s very likely you would spend about $3000 in repairs over a 4 year period with out any unreasonable factors increasing the chance of breakdown. That means the value of the car is only $3,500 over a four year period. To simplify, if you bought a car for $9,000 and it had little to no repairs in a 4 year period, you would be getting a better investment for your money.

Vehicle shopping on cost alone is the single biggest problem with unsatisfied vehicle customers. When you shop with value in mind, you will have a better perception of what you will really be spending and it will help you determine whether you are getting the best bang for your buck!

What To Do If You Are In A Car Accident

Sunday, August 8th, 2010

Annually, thousands of people in the United States perish in car accidents and many more are injured. If you survive the ordeal, do you know how to act later? Knowing what to do is essential because this can minimize injuries, keep costs down and hasten the repair process.

First, be prepared by having an emergency kit in your glove compartment. Always carry a cell phone, pen and paper to take notes, a flashlight, a disposable camera to take shots of the vehicles, and a card containing information about your allergies or conditions that need special attention in the event of an accident. Also have a list of contact numbers of law enforcement agencies in case you need to call them. Other necessities that you can keep in the trunk include a set of cones, warning triangles or emergency flares.

If you’ve figured in a minor accident and have no serious injuries, move your vehicle to the side of the road and out of the way of other vehicles. Leaving your car in the middle of the road can lead to more accidents and injuries. If you cant move your car, stay in the vehicle with seat belts on until help arrives. Switch on hazard lights and use cones, flares or warning triangles to alert other vehicles of your problem.

Swap information with the other driver. Know his name, address, phone number, insurance company, policy number, driver license number and license plate number. If the driver’s name is not similar to the one insured, find out know how they are related and get the name and address of all people.

Know every car involved in the accident – the year, make, model and color – including the exact location of the accident. Remain polite and try to remain calm. Keeping a level head can prevent future problems from arising later on.

What To Do After A Car Accident

Tuesday, July 6th, 2010

Not stopping at the scene of an accident, if you think the accident has caused injury or damage to property is against the law. Ensure that you do all that you can to make the scene safe. Everyone should switch off their engines, turn on hazard lights and make sure oncoming traffic is warned of the accident scene. Dial 999 if someone is injured, or if anyone leaves the scene without giving their details. If you believe that the accident scene may be a hazard to other drivers, call 999.

Do not take the blame even if you think the cause of the accident is clear. Draw a sketch of how the accident happened whilst you are still at the scene. Note down vehicle locations and the direction they were travelling in, skid marks, street names, collision points and any damage. Back this up with lots of photos, a mobile phone camera is usually OK for this.

By law, all drivers involved in the actual accident must give their contact details to each other. Note down names, addresses, phone numbers and insurance details for each vehicle involved. Also take down the names and addresses of any witnesses, including passengers from the other vehicles involved.

Add other details you think may be of importance, for example if the other driver appears to have been drinking or using a mobile phone make a note of this and why you believe this to be the case. Weather conditions may have contributed to the accident, e.g. rain or fog, if relevant make a note of this too. Any damage to the road surface or cars parked in such away as to contribute to the accident should be noted too.

If you hit a farm animal or dog you must report that incident to the police. If you hit a wild animal or cat you do not have to report it, as long as the animal is not injured or suffering. Always stop to check the condition of the animal, but stop in a safe place and walk back to find the animal if you need to.

Report all accidents to your insurance company even if you do not plan to make a claim. Make a photocopy of all notes and photos and send these to your insurance company as soon as possible after the accident.
